Genuine OEM Infiniti Parts Warranty
All Genuine INFINITI parts are custom-fitted, custom-designed, and durability-tested for your INFINITI, and come with a INFINITI-backed 12 month/12,000 mile (whichever occurs first) limited warranty (if installed by dealer at the time of purchase). Genuine OEM Infiniti Accessories Warranty
Genuine INFINITI Accessories are covered by INFINITIs Limited Warranty on Genuine INFINITI Replacement parts and Genuine INFINITI Accessories for the longer of 12 months/12,000 miles (whichever occurs first) or the remaining period under the 4-year/60,000-mile (whichever occurs first) INFINITI New Vehicle Limited Warranty. All non-genuine INFINITI Accessories are not warranted by INFINITI. Refer to accessory product manufacturer for warranty details. INFINITI limited warranty also does not cover damages or failures to the vehicle caused by improper installation or alterations. Damage or failures caused by use of non-INFINITI-affiliated parts/accessories are also excluded from INFINITI warranty coverage. Motorsports accessories are not genuine INFINITI parts/accessories. Motorsports parts are sold ""AS IS"" without warranties, express or implied (including all warranties of merchantability or fitness for a particular purpose), unless expressly prohibited from doing so by applicable law, in which case the warranty provided is the minimum required by law. Damage or failures caused by use of this part are also excluded from warranty coverage. Read the new vehicle limited warranty information booklet or contact your retailer for details. The installation of a Motorsports competition part on a vehicle intended for use on public streets or highways may violate laws and regulations relating to motor vehicle safety standards or emission regulations.
